Output edcaab2cc4e283ddc27ef153b2d4ceec257de3bac17c06fa4448ab9481210c0e:4

value
29535991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8a332c706d43b6ea8f9be3c1e4207689820977 OP_EQUAL
address
MR64pnrnfWrkd7PfTDcAe7dFuN2HBvTyRw
transaction
edcaab2cc4e283ddc27ef153b2d4ceec257de3bac17c06fa4448ab9481210c0e
spent
true